Item Description
Original illustrated cardboard box contains 6" tall figure w/hard plastic arms, head, body and painted tin legs. Includes separate chain necklace w/plastic medallion and looks more like large Great Garloo. Toy comes w/wind-up key as produced and works. Toy walks forward while arms move up and down. This is the later version which features plastic head, body, necklace and leopard skin loin cloth versus lithographed earlier version. Marx, 1960s. Box shows scattered lt. aging/wear w/small punctures on both sides. Small tear at top flap. Scattered lt. creasing but complete, glossy and VG. Figure has lt. aging/wear. Lt. wear on head. Displays VF. overall. Michael Lartigaut Collection.
